My friends today’s scripture is challenging and might feel harsh. Jesus is addressing the religious leaders but we can all receive a lesson in His words. Never underestimate the power of your words and never forget the Lord is ALWAYS listening. 

Matthew 12:34-37

You brood of snakes! How could evil men like you speak what is good and right? For whatever is in your heart determines what you say. 35 A good person produces good things from the treasury of a good heart, and an evil person produces evil things from the treasury of an evil heart. 36 And I tell you this, you must give an account on judgment day for every idle word you speak. 37 The words you say will either acquit you or condemn you.”

I personally think today’s scripture is clear and easy to understand. As I said yesterday I like to talk so this is a little scary in my flesh. The main point to see, the words we speak reflect our hearts. How many times have you said something and then it is followed by, “sorry I didn’t mean to say that?” The truth is, what you said proceeded from your heart, you just didn’t want to make it public. 

Our words should be used as a warning for all of us. If our words are negative, hurtful or unnecessary we should stop and evaluate our hearts. We need to immediately ask ourselves “are we walking in the Spirit or our flesh?” Remember the Spirit of God living in you is producing good things, love, joy, peace, patience, kindness, goodness, faithfulness, gentleness and self control. If your words do not represent this fruit they are not from God. Therefore we are told; we will give an account for our words.

If we are walking in the Spirit there will be no problem with the words we speak. Just as Jesus only spoke the words His Father gave Him we can do the same. I want to encourage you, it is a new day, full of God’s mercies and faithfulness. Walk in His power and watch your speech dramatically change!
